About us

Access Telehealth was built by medical professionals to achieve one goal connecting people to healthcare.

We are a leading provider in the Telehealth sector. With strong investment in research and development our company has seen excellent growth in recent years.

Through our growing network of clinicians across General Practice Allied Health Nursing and Specialists we deliver improved health outcomes to:

  • Rural and Remote Australians
  • Indigenous Communities
  • Aged Care Residents and
  • NDIS Participants

Access Therapist is an offspring to Access Telehealth and is our Allied Health Division. Access Therapist makes it easier for NDIS Participants to access quality occupational therapy speech pathology psychology and mental health social work services from the comfort of their own home.

Our easytouse software manages and facilitates secure video consultations that allow NDIS Participants patients utilising Care Plans and private therapy across Australia to access specialist healthcare with reduced wait times.

Access Telehealth removes the barrier of travel and location and delivers improved health outcomes within the boundaries of the NDIS price guidelines.

About the role

As a result of a growing business need we have a unique opportunity for an Occupational Therapist available. This role will be responsible for providing occupational therapy services via telehealth to persons presenting with a range of needs.

Working via telehealth you will be responsible for assessments programs and reporting.

A key focus of your role will be to empower clients and their families to make positive choices related to community support and independence.

This position reports to the Occupational Therapist Clinical Lead and is a contract role offering up to 20 hours per week where you will work from the comfort of your own home. The role is super flexible! We will tailor your caseload to your skill set! This is your opportunity to work how you want when you want!

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ide highquality specialist care to clients to optimise and improve their health and functional outcomes
  • Effectively manage a designated caseload
  • Maintain client files inclusive of timely notes
  • Liaise and build rapport with clients their families and other members of their support network
  • Provide a range of Telehealth OT assessments and interventions to assist clients to maximise their independence and wellbeing
  • If you have the skill set or are willing to learn make recommendations relating to equipment and home modifications that are clinically reasonable and within policy and legislative guidelines
  • Evaluate OT intervention programs and modify plans as required to facilitate the achievement of goals
  • Initiate funding requests for ongoing OT intervention and followup approvals
  • Ensure that clinical processes reflect best practice and are of the highest industry standard
  • Abide by Access Telehealths policies and procedures inclusive of incident reporting and complaints management processes
  • Diary management and responsibility for followup appointment scheduling to meet client needs

About You

  • Undergraduate qualification in Occupational Therapy
  • At least 5 years postqualification experience
  • Experience with and strong understanding of the health aged and disability sectors preferably within a telehealth setting
  • Exceptional verbal and nonverbal communication skills
  • Ability to prioritise and manage a varied clinical caseload
  • Highly organised and efficient
  • Refined report writing skills
  • Specialisation in Psychosocial/Paediatric specialties experience with a mixed caseload preferred
  • Must be available to work after school hours

To be able to undertake this role you will require the following prior to commencement:

  • NDIS Working Screening Check (NDISWC)
  • Working with Children Check or the Working with Vulnerable People Check (WWCC / WWVPC)
  • Professional Indemnity Insurance
  • Drivers License and a registered and insured vehicle
